Output e89648dce16f7a5bedc987c90c26f771c043bf1925661c167bceec8c2efa338a:1

value
16015923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ea817d18424e3da65e92bfd89b5309a61945ba1c OP_EQUAL
address
3P4yATi4xdjaoWsoymMxzn5iA7ebfmeVtJ
transaction
e89648dce16f7a5bedc987c90c26f771c043bf1925661c167bceec8c2efa338a
spent
true